Volume 2 Governance and ControlsGovernance and Controls © Copyright 2002, All rights reserved 38 Any discrepancies identified during the monthly invoice checkout process should be documented in an issue database and assigned to an individual for resolution. This individual should contact the appropriate internal and external groups to receive information supporting a resolution of the discrepancy. From this information, the individual should determine the resolution of the discrepancy, gain agreement from the counterparty, and, if required, post a system adjustment that reflects the resolution. The issue database should then be cleared of the discrepancy. Checkout procedures should be documented for reference. An issue database should be used to track patterns of discrepancies, as sorted by counterparty, location, transport contract, or dealmaker, with the patterns being communicated to appropriate personnel for active management. Settlement statements should be netted where possible, aggregating purchases and sales by counterparty. Intercompany transactions should be confirmed and net amounts captured in financial records. Issues database reports. 1.4.2 Settlements Process Overview The settlement process performed by the back office includes verification of information between the parties in a transaction and the procedures used to account for transactions the back office also initiates billings and payments. These functions should be performed independently of the trading, trade processing, and reconciliation functions. Objectives Ensure that cash and security movements are properly authorized and executed. Best Practices and Controls Standard settlement and delivery instructions should be established for all counterparties. This includes setting up proper controls for establishing and authorizing instructions, for changing previously approved instructions, for structured transactions, and for non-standard deals. Telephone conversations regarding settlement issues should be recorded.
